In Wesleyville, PA, Erie County, there was a 15% increase in opioid-related hospitalizations in 2022.
Erie County recorded 78 drug overdose deaths in Wesleyville, PA in 2022.
In 2021, 22% of drug-related arrests in Erie County occurred in Wesleyville, PA.
Wesleyville, PA saw a 10% rise in methamphetamine usage rates in 2022 according to Erie County health reports.
Erie County's Wesleyville reported over 150 cases of drug abuse treatment admissions in 2021.
A survey in 2022 showed that 6% of high school students in Wesleyville, PA had tried illicit drugs.
Employers in Wesleyville, PA, are taking significant steps to ensure a drug-free workplace. Many local businesses have adopted comprehensive drug testing policies, which include pre-employment screenings and random drug tests for current employees. These policies are in line with state regulations outlined by the Pennsylvania Department of Labor & Industry.
In addition to formal testing policies, many establishments provide educational resources and support for employees struggling with addiction. This holistic approach not only promotes a safer working environment but also aids individuals in seeking the help they need. Employers often collaborate with local healthcare providers to facilitate employee access to treatment services.
The government of Wesleyville, PA, in collaboration with Erie County, has implemented several initiatives aimed at combating drug abuse. These include funding for local rehab centers and public awareness campaigns focusing on prevention and treatment. More details can be found on the Erie County Health Department website.
State-level efforts have also played a crucial role. The Pennsylvania Department of Drug and Alcohol Programs offers resources and guidance to local communities, including Wesleyville. Their comprehensive plan focuses on prevention, treatment, and recovery support services. Additional information can be found on the PA Drug and Alcohol Programs.
Wesleyville, PA, has witnessed a series of notable drug busts in recent years, underscoring the ongoing efforts to combat illegal drug activities. In 2023, Erie County law enforcement officials made a significant seizure of methamphetamine, valued at over $250,000. The operation involved coordinated efforts among various agencies, leading to multiple arrests.
In another incident, a drug-related event in 2022 led to the confiscation of several firearms and significant quantities of heroin and cocaine. This was part of a broader investigative effort targeting drug trafficking rings in and around the area. These events highlight the active presence of law enforcement and their commitment to reducing drug-related crime in Wesleyville.
